The major commercial film industry in the United States is in Hollywood, while much of the independent film industry is in New York City. The following studios are considered to be the most prevalent of the independent studios (they are used to produce/release independent films and foreign-language films):

Lions Gate Films

Fox Searchlight Pictures

Focus Features/Rogue Pictures

Sony Pictures Classics

IFC Films

Samuel Goldwyn Films

Warner Independent Pictures

The Weinstein Company/Dimension Films

Magnolia Pictures

Paramount Vantage

Palm Pictures

Tartan Films

Newmarket Films

Picturehouse (formerly Fine Line Features, before Time Warner acquired Newmarket's distribution arm, and merged it with Fine Line to form Picturehouse, a joint venture of HBO and New Line Cinema)

ThinkFilm

Miramax Films

Troma Entertainment
